Cattyman

/ˈkætimən/ noun

A person who tends to, raises, or manages cattle; a cowboy or ranch hand who works with livestock.

Compound of cattle + man, following the pattern of occupational terms like milkman or horseman. Used historically to describe workers in pastoral and agricultural societies.
